DiVitas develops a new class of unified mobile communications solutions that extends the reach of the enterprise by providing seamless roaming between Wi-Fi and cellular networks. DiVitas' solution works in any network environment, whether it is cellular, Wi-Fi, Internet/IP WAN, or wireline, and with every type of mobile phone, including dual-mode phones, WLAN phones, cellular phones, smartphones, and softphones, and with every PBX. The company's solution also integrates with business and communications applications. Because enterprises own the DiVitas solutions, administrators can control and manage communications centrally, without having to rely on service providers.

About DiVitas Networks
DiVitas Networks provides mobile unified communications solutions for
both small and large businesses. DiVitas mobilizes business
communications (voice, IM, presence and contacts) seamlessly over any
mobile network – cellular or WiFi or both – using a client that can run
on any mobile handset and a server that can be controlled by company
IT. DiVitas is the first mobile unified communications solution that
allows companies the flexibility of either deploying it in an
all-in-one green-field mode or overlaying it on top of existing
infrastructure. DiVitas provides organizations complete management and
control over their mobile unified communications. Headquartered in
Mountain View, California, DiVitas Networks is backed by Clearstone
Venture Partners and Menlo Ventures and has received two rounds of
financing totaling $23 million to date. More information is available
